Acquisition or Disposition of Assets (a) On September 21, 2000 Metawave Communications Corporation a Delaware corporation (the "Company") acquired Adaptive Telecom, Inc., a ------- California corporation ("Target"), by the statutory merger (the "Merger") of ------ ------ Malibu Acquisition Corporation, a Delaware corporation and wholly-owned subsidiary of the Company ("Company Sub"), with and into Target. The Merger was ----------- accomplished pursuant to the Amended and Restated Agreement and Plan of Merger, dated as of September 20, 2000, among the Company, Target and Company Sub (the "Merger Agreement"). The Merger occurred following the approval of the Merger ----------------- Agreement by the shareholders of the Target pursuant to a written shareholder consent and satisfaction of certain other closing conditions. As a result of the Merger, the Company became the owner of 100% of the issued and outstanding shares of Target Common Stock and each outstanding share of Target Common Stock and each outstanding option to acquire Target Common Stock was converted into 0.5516 shares of the Company's Common Stock or an option to acquire 0.5516 shares of such Common Stock, as the case may be. A total of approximately 5,500,000 shares of the Company's Common Stock will be issued to former Target shareholders and optionholders in exchange for the acquisition by the Company of all outstanding Target capital stock and all unexpired and unexercised options to acquire Target capital stock. The shares issued to former Target shareholders are to be registered for resale pursuant to a resale registration statement on Form S-1, pursuant to the Securities Act of 1933, as amended, which is expected to become effective on or about October 24, 2000. Outstanding options to purchase Target Common Stock were assumed by the Company and remain outstanding as options to purchase shares of the Company's Common Stock. Under the terms of the Merger Agreement and a related Escrow Agreement dated September 20, 2000, a total of 412,500 shares of the Company's Common Stock will be held in escrow for the purpose of indemnifying the Company and its respective affiliates, officers, directors, employees, representatives and agents against certain liabilities of Target. Such escrow will expire on September 20, 2001. The Acquisition will be accounted for as a purchase transaction. The ratio at which Company's stock was exchanged for Target's stock was determined pursuant to a formula set forth in the Merger Agreement. The formula was agreed upon in arms' length negotiations and took account of several factors concerning the relative valuations of the Company and Target. Item 7.
